In the following we describe the setting for AL1. You can program AL2 in the
same way. If during the setting procedure no button is pressed for approx. 8
seconds, the settings are applied and the setting mode is quit.
 Press the "M-/AL1" button (14) for approx. 1 second. The hours flash on the
display (6).
 Press the "VOL-" (12) or "VOL+" (4) buttons to set the desired hour of the
alarm time. You can keep the buttons pressed to accelerate the digits count.
Press the "M-/AL1" button (14) briefly to apply the setting. The minutes flash
on the display (6).
 Press the "VOL-" (12) or "VOL+" (4) buttons to set the desired minutes of the
alarm time. You can keep the buttons pressed to accelerate the digits count.
Press the "M-/AL1" button (14) briefly to apply the setting.
 Now you can press the "VOL-" (12) or "VOL+" (4) button to select if you
want to wake-up with the buzzer ("bUZZ") or the radio ("rdA"). Press the "M-
/AL1" button (14) to confirm your selection.
 Now you can press the "VOL-" (12) or "VOL+" (4) buttons to set the desired
alarm volume. Press the "M-/AL1" button (14) briefly to apply the setting.
 Finally you can select the days of the week for which you want enable the
set alarm. Press the "VOL-" (12) and "VOL +" (4) buttons to toggle between
the following options:
Individual days of the week
Days of the week from Monday to Friday
Weekend Saturday and Sunday
All days of the week
Press the "M-/AL1" button (14) briefly to apply the setting.
You have finished setting the alarm time.
